Answer:

The answer is 68 ft

Explanation:

Since the triangle is a right angled triangle we can use Pythagoras theorem to find the missing side a

Using Pythagoras theorem we have

a² = b² + c²

where

a is the hypotenuse

So we have


{a}^(2) = {60}^(2) + {32}^(2) \\ a = √(3600 + 1024) \\ a = √(4624)

We have the final answer as

68 ft
